By: n/a Dr. Julie Sorenson, a renowned mental health expert, introduces a new initiative aimed at suicide prevention for youth. With a Doctorate in Marriage and Family Therapy (DMFT), Dr. Sorenson has developed resources to help children build emotional resilience. Her new book, Let the Sunshine in From the Black Hole, uses personification to address suicide prevention for children in grades 3-5, offering educators, therapists, and caregivers essential tools to support kids facing mental health challenges. Dr. Sorenson also released The Teacher Component for Suicide Prevention, a comprehensive guide featuring historical context, warning signs, and lesson plans to assist educators in sensitive discussions with at-risk students. Dr. Sorenson's work, including her previous books like A Nasty Virus Struck the World and Social What?, empowers parents, educators, and caregivers with the tools to support children's emotional well-being.
